#dcc68e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#dcc68e is composed of 86.3% red, 77.6% green and 55.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 10% magenta, 35.5% yellow and 13.7% black. It has a hue angle of 43.1 degrees, a saturation of 52.7% and a lightness of 71%. #dcc68e color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#b98d1d. Closest websafe color is: #cccc99.

Shades and Tints of #dcc68e

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#070502 is the darkest color, while #fcfbf7 is the lightest one.

Tones of #dcc68e

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#bab7b0 is the less saturated color, while #fed56c is the most saturated one.
